Quick Overview
This workflow monitors unread Gmail messages labeled “sales”, uses Google Gemini to extract structured deal updates and a suggested reply, writes the deal and next action to Google Sheets, drafts a follow-up email in the original thread, and posts Slack alerts for high-risk or closed-won deals.
How it works
Triggers every minute when an unread email arrives in Gmail with the label “sales”.
Sends the email content to Google Gemini to extract a JSON CRM update (company, contact, stage, sentiment, objections, next action, due date, risk) and a short draft reply.
Normalizes the extracted fields and prepares a single deal record keyed by the sender’s email plus a task-style next action.
Appends or updates a “Deals” row in Google Sheets and then appends the next action to a “Tasks” sheet.
Creates a Gmail draft reply addressed to the client in the same email thread.
Posts a Slack message to the selected channel if the deal risk is high or if the stage is closed_won, then marks the original email as read.
Setup
Connect credentials for Gmail, Google Gemini (PaLM) API, Google Sheets, and Slack.
Create (or choose) a Gmail label named “sales” and ensure sales emails are labeled so they match the trigger filter.
Select the target Google Sheets spreadsheet and set up “Deals” and “Tasks” tabs/worksheets with columns that match the fields you want to store.
Choose the Slack channel (for example, #sales) where high-risk alerts and closed-won announcements should post.
